Quick orientation for the security review: Tickwatch is the service we stood up to chase the cron drift issue on the Marrowgate fleet. Three environments — dev, drift-lab, and prod-shadow. Drift-lab deliberately skews node clocks to reproduce the bug, so don't be alarmed by timestamp weirdness there. Prod-shadow mirrors real schedules read-only; it can't trigger jobs. Access is scoped per environment, and nothing in drift-lab touches tenant data. The drift-lab environment currently runs with these settings.

deployment values, yahag-tawef:
ZORWYN_HOST=zorwyn.tolvaqlabs.internal
ZORWYN_PORT=9300

**Vendor note: Inkmill markdown pipeline**

Rendering for Parchway docs is outsourced to Inkmill under an annual contract, renewing each March. They handle sanitization and PDF export; we own the upload queue. SLA: 4-hour response on rendering failures. Escalate only after two failed retries. Their support desk is reachable at the address below.

billing contact of hahaf-baguf = zorael.tammir.jorius@sivrelhq.internal

Onboarding: the Fareflip pricing experiment

Hi new folks! You'll see tickets about "weird prices" on Dockpond events — that's our Fareflip experiment, which shows 10% of visitors a dynamic ticket price. Don't panic, it's intentional. If you need to reproduce a customer's view locally, enable the experiment in your .env with FAREFLIP_ENABLED=true and set your cohort to "variant_b". The experiment service also needs its API secret, so add this line right after:

secret setting of yajog-taguf: ARCHIVE_KEY3=051

Leadership Review Briefing — FY Headcount Plan
Welcome aboard! Quick picture for next year: net growth of 22 roles, weighted toward the Calloway platform team and customer success. Backfills run as usual; new roles need your sign-off after Q1. Budget assumes modest salary inflation and two senior hires in Dornmere. Full model in the planning folder. One restricted note for you sits below.

board note of tadup-tajog: Headcount on the Oliiel team goes from 31 to 88 by the end of February. Gross margin on Oliiel came in at 62 percent against a plan of 29 percent.